Blown Double Glazing Repairs Near Me

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gMost double glazing comes with a warranty, usually 10 or 20 years old, however some companies offer lifetime guarantees. Be sure to check yours and to obtain a copy of any agreements you've made.

If you see condensation or misting on your windows, this is an indication of a damaged seal. This lets moisture get into the insulation section. This can cause problems, so it's best to repair the issue immediately.

Windows that have been misty

It can be a nuisance and unappealing when windows mist however it could also indicate a problem in the insulation and sealing of the double glazing. This means that your windows aren't keeping you as comfortable and quiet as they should and you could be spending money to heat a room when windows let out heat.

The leakage of moisture can occur between the two glass panes in double-glazed windows. This is caused by gaskets that are perishable which breaks down over time. The leaking moisture allows air to flow in and out of the window, causing condensation between the glass panes.

If you have misted windows the quickest method to fix them is to get an expert for a blown double glazing repair near me. They will replace the glass unit in the window. This will not only remove the condensation, but also ensure that your windows are properly insulated and sealed. This is also a chance to upgrade your double-glazed units to energy-efficient glazing with an A rating. This will reduce your heating costs.

You shouldn't attempt to clean your own windows. Utilizing strong solvents or cleaning products will cause the seals on your windows to degrade more quickly, leading to a faster degradation in the seal's quality and more water to escape through. This could be risky, as the moisture could be sucked in to the window and property and pose a threat to your health.

Some companies claim that they can fix misted double-glazing by drilling holes in the window and injecting chemical compounds that absorb water from the double-glazing unit. However this is not an effective solution over the long term. While this may temporarily remove the fog and condensation from windows, it does not address the root issue of a damaged seal that will inevitably be re-introduced.

Contacting a local company offering repair of blown double glazing is the most efficient and cost-effective solution to fix the misty glass window. The window glass will be replaced within the frame. This is a much less expensive alternative to replacing the entire window, and it will still give you the advantages of an insulated home.

Draughty Windows

A drafty window can allow cold air to enter your home and can cause you to make use of more energy to heat your home Therefore, it is essential to fix the issue as soon as you can. Most draughty window problems can be fixed easily and will save you money while making your home more peaceful and comfortable.

Firstly, it is worthwhile to check if your double glazing is still under warranty and speaking with the installers if this is the case, as they might be able fix the issue for you. If you are unable to resolve the warranty issue, the next step should be to examine the window fittings for any issues, such as hinges or locks that may cause drafts.

If you notice that your double-glazed is leaking, or the glass is fogged up and Upvc door repairs near Me you are unable to wipe it off, this indicates that the seal between the panes has broken and they need to be replaced. Double-glazed windows that fail allow cold air to enter your home. They also lose their thermally insulating gas which makes them less efficient than they were in the past.

You can apply GapSeal, an online sealant that is flexible. It expands as it is dried. It can be applied to any gaps in your double glazed window that are as wide as 7mm wide and can be easily removed. It is recommended to fill small cracks in your window, but it can also be used for larger areas like around the frame or even on doors that are draughty. To get the best results, you should apply the sealant to a clean surface, and allow it to dry for 24 hours before use. If your double glazing appears damp however there aren't any leaks or cracks it's likely that the frame doesn't fit properly against the wall. This can be easily fixed by adjusting the frame using small screwdrivers or pliers.

Cracked Panes of Glass

Cracks in double-pane windows aren't something that you can fix just with a little super glue. A damaged pane means the glass does not have an airtight sealing, which is essential to prevent heat loss and enhancing energy efficiency. A professional can fix the glass layer of a window that has not completely cracked. This will keep the window functioning properly.

If the glass that has been damaged isn't shattered, it's still an ideal idea to speak with an expert in repairs, but they can usually offer a short-term solution that entails placing an adhesive between the cracks. This could be a special type of tape or putty that protects the glass from further cracking and keeps it in place for a period of time. This is a temporary fix, though, and the window is required to be replaced as soon as is feasible to stop the weather damage.

Stress cracks usually begin at the edge of a window and spread across it in time, especially when there is a significant temperature difference between one side of the glass and another. They may also develop due to repeated physical stress, for example, closing the window. The cracks typically are curving and look like the outline of an hour-glass.

It's generally not a great idea to try to remove and replace a damaged double-pane window by yourself, since the job requires tools that are specially designed for. It can be dangerous to attempt this yourself, particularly when your skills aren't up to par. It's always better to have an expert handle this for you particularly if the window is in an elevated location and/or has sentimental items.

In most cases professionals will employ a chemical product that can be applied to the glass and left to dry before applying an adhesive to the crack. The product is made up of resin and a hardener. It will need to mix thoroughly for at least twenty minutes. The resin needs to be allowed to set for approximately 10 minutes before it can be handled. After the epoxy is set, a clean rag moistened with acetone can be used to scrape off any excess.
